[Source: Transport Topics] — New York Gov. Andrew Cuomo announced the availability of $87 million for port and rail improvements in an effort to enhance the state’s trade corridors,
The grants are intended to spur economic competitiveness and support the resiliency of critical infrastructure.
Project activities eligible for funding include wharf and dock reconstruction, dredging, resurfacing at highway-rail grade crossings, track and bridge rehabilitation and terminal construction. As well as enhancing economic competitiveness, the projects are supposed to help with reducing greenhouse gas emissions.
